True, although unlike a taxi, I can see during the trip the route the driver should be taking and, after the trip, I can see the route the driver actuall took.

And, if the route taken is unreasonably different from the optimal route, I can complain to Uber and get a refund.

So yes, while drivers may be incentivised to take longer routes, they can’t do it without being exposed.
